MAX2642, MAX2643

900MHz SiGe, High-Variable IP3, Low-Noise Amplifier

Description

The MAX2642/MAX2643 low-cost, high third-order intercept point (IP3), low-noise amplifiers (LNAs) are designed for applications in cellular, ISM, SMR, and PMR systems. They feature a programmable bias, allowing the IP3 and supply current to be optimized for specific applications. These LNAs provide up to 0dBm input IP3 while maintaining a low noise figure of 1.3dB.

The gain for these devices is typically 17dB. The MAX2642 also features a 13dB attenuation step, which extends the LNA's dynamic range. Both devices feature a shutdown mode that minimizes power consumption. On-chip output matching saves board space by reducing the number of external components.

The MAX2642/MAX2643 are designed on a low-noise, advanced silicon-germanium (SiGe) process technology. They operate from a +2.7V to +5.5V single supply and are available in the ultra-small 6-pin SC70 package.

Key Features

  • Wide Frequency Range: 800MHz to 1000MHz
  • High Output IP3 and Adjustable
    • +17dBm at 5.3mA
    • +7dBm at 2.8mA
  • Low Noise Figure: 1.3dB at 900MHz
  • 13dB Attenuation Step (MAX2642)
  • On-Chip Output Matching
  • Low-Power Shutdown Mode
  • +2.7V to +5.5V Single-Supply Operation
  • Ultra-Small SC70-6 Package
 

Applications/Uses

  • 800MHz/900MHz Cellular Phones
  • 868MHz/900MHz ISM-Band Wireless Data
  • 900MHz Cordless Phones
  • PMR/SMR/LMR
